自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 收藏
  • 关注

原创 Java基础——继承

Java基础——继承 Java只支持单继承,不允许多重继承 一个子类只能有一个父类 一个父类可以派生出多个子类 子类继承了父类,就继承了父类的方法和属性。在子类中,可以使用父类中定义的方法和属性,也可以创建新的数据和方法,同时可以重写父类的方法,因而,子类通常比父类的功能更多。在Java 中,继承的关键字用的是“extends”,即子类是对父类的“扩展”。 在Java类中使用super关键字来...

2019-01-15 15:11:19 178

原创 Java基础——封装

Java基础——封装 封装的意义: 使用者对类内部定义的属性(对象的成员变量)的直接操作会导致数据 的错误、混乱或安全性问题。Java中通过将数据声明为私有的(private),再提供公开的(public)方法:getXXX和setXXX实现对该属性的操作,以实现下述目的: 1、隐藏一个类的实现细节; 2、使用者只能通过事先定制好的方法来访问数据,可以方便地加入控制逻辑,限制对属性的不合理操作; ...

2019-01-10 19:08:18 199

原创 Java基础——类与对象

Java基础——类与对象 面向过程:强调功能行为。 面向对象:将功能封装进对象,强调具备了功能的对象。 面向对象的三大特征: 封装 将代码和其操作的数据捆绑在一起,防止外部对数据和代码的干扰。数据和代码以封装的形式链接起来就构成了一个对象 隐藏内部功能的具体实现,只保留和外部交流数据的接口。就好比电视机,用一个外壳把内部零部件及控制电路封装起来,只提供按钮或者遥控器接口供人使用。 继承 一个对象获...

2019-01-10 18:58:52 112

原创 Java基础——方法

Java基础——方法 什么是方法? 方法就是把一堆重复的代码封装起来,如果别的程序需要用到这一段代码时,直接调用方法即可 可以把方法当成一个工厂 比如钢铁工厂 材料:铁矿 产出物:钢铁 程序中的方法: 参数(材料):进入方法的数据 返回值(产出物):方法根据参数处理后的结果 怎么定义一个方法??、 访问修饰符 方法返回类型 方法名(参数类型 参数名){ 方法体; return 返回值; } 访问...

2019-01-09 18:42:14 118

原创 Java基础——数组

Java基础——数组 定义: 数据类型[] 数组名;int [] a; 数据类型 数组名[];int a[]; Java在定义数组时并不为数组元素分配内存,因此[]中无需指定数组元素的个数. 静态初始化: int a[] = {1,2,3,4}; 动态初始化: int a[] = new int[3]; a[0]=1;… 二维数组: int a[][]= { {1,2}, {2,3}, {4,5}...

2019-01-09 17:18:18 163

原创 Java基础——循环结构

Java基础——循环结构

2019-01-04 16:27:06 196

原创 Java基础——顺序结构及条件结构

Java基础——顺序结构及条件结构 顺序结构: 顺序结构是程序中最简单最基本的流程控制,没有特定的语法结构,按照代码的先后顺序,依次执行。 输入数据: 先导入java.util.Scanner包(放在class定义上面)——>import java.util.Scanner; 创建对象(在类中)——>Scanner input=new Scanner(System.in); 接收数据—...

2019-01-04 16:11:13 520

原创 Java基础——变量与运算

Java基础——变量与运算 编写规则: Java源文件以“java”扩展名 一个源文件中最多只能有一个public类,其他类的个数不限。如果源文件包含一个public类,则文件名必须按该类名命名。 Java应用程序的执行入口是main()方法 Java语言严格区分大小写 注释: 单行注释 // 多行注释 /** */ 关键字: 定义:被Java语言赋予了特殊含义,用做专门用途的字符...

2019-01-03 09:32:42 153

原创 Java基础——Java入门与环境搭建

Java基础——Java入门与环境搭建 软件: 软件即一系列按照特定顺序组织的计算机数据和指令的集合,分为系统软件和应用软件。 JAVA语言的特点: 1、完全面向对象 2、健壮性 3、跨平台性 Java两大核心机制: 1、Java虚拟机(Java Virtual Machine) JVM是一个虚拟的计算机,具有指令集并使用不同的存储区域,负责执行指令,管理数据、内存、寄存器。用于运行Java应用...

2019-01-02 20:14:17 287

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除